- Description
- Predicted to enable actin filament binding activity and microfilament motor activity. Predicted to be involved in system development. Predicted to be located in myofibril. Predicted to be part of myosin II complex. Predicted to be active in cytoplasm and myosin filament. Human ortholog(s) of this gene implicated in arthrogryposis multiplex congenita; congenital myopathy 6; disease of cellular proliferation; distal arthrogryposis type 7; and inclusion body myositis. Orthologous to several human genes including MYH1 (myosin heavy chain 1); MYH2 (myosin heavy chain 2); and MYH4 (myosin heavy chain 4).
